Outdoor Home Design Tips: Simple Gardening Hacks for Beginners

Since spring is finally coming, it is probably the best time to start creating a beautiful garden outside the home. For those who don't have gardening experience, listed below is a simple gardening guide for beginners.

According to Real Simple, the first step in creating a beautiful garden is to be knowledgeable about the region. The plants in the garden must be determined by the location of the home. It is important to understand the limits and the possibilities of the different plants which can grow in the garden depending on the region's climate and soil.

The next thing that needs to be done is to test the soil. Understanding how pH and nutrient levels can affect the growth of plants is very helpful in planning the garden. The soil should be easily shoveled and should crumble in the hands for plants to grow. Soil that is hard and clay-like will make it difficult for the plants to grow, so it is best to add fresh soil and compost.

Huffington Post also said that for beginners, it is important to start small. Make a plan of what garden would be the best depending on the conditions that were given above. Starting with easy-to-grow plants like sunflower and growing vegetable plants could be a good headstart for the garden. In time, there will be a lot of opportunities to let the garden grow, and new plants can be added.

Lastly, know the right tools. It is better to keep a notebook and a calendar to track the garden activity. Gardening is a long process, and it needs a lot of patience for it to grow beautifully. Do not also forget to be consistent in giving ample amounts of water to the plants. The amount of water can vary from plant to plant.
